Isabelle D. Crook

August 27, 1929 — October 29, 2009

Isabelle D. Crook,80, formerly of Silver Lake Ave, Wakefield, died Thursday. Born in Pawtucket, she was the daughter of the late Walter J. and Imelda J. (Chartier) Dusseault. Mrs. Crook taught for the Armed Services in Japan and France and was a School Teacher for the Exeter Public School System for over twelve years before retiring in 1974. She was a graduate of RISD and RIC and was a communicant of St. Francis of Assisi Church. She was the mother of Matthew, Frank and Andrew Crook; sister of Louis Dusseault, Therese Carrol, Pauline Byron, Aline Caspoli and the late Bernard Dusseault and grandmother of Lucas and Cameron Crook. Visiting hours Tuesday 10-12, followed by a service at 12:00 PM in the Avery-Storti Funeral Home, 88 Columbia St., Wakefield. Burial will be in St. Francis Cemetery.
